Solution

The correct option is D The rope will move towards team P.
Force applied by team P:
All members of team P are pulling the rope towards themselves, i.e applying the force in the same direction and towards the left of us. Therefore, all forces will add up.
Therefore, total force applied by team P = 125 N + 137 N + 209 N = 471 N (towards left of us)

Similarly, the forces applied by all members of team Q is in the same direction and towards the right direction of us .
Therefore the total force applied by team Q = 129 N + 186 N + 146 N = 461 N (towards right of us)

Since the force applied by team P is in opposite direction of team Q, therefore, they will get subtract.
Therefore,
Net force on the rope = 471 N (towards left) - 461 N (towards right)
= 10 N (towards left)

As, the net force is acting towards left direction, i.e. towards team P, therefore the rope will move towards team P.
